Earlier this week, the AlliedOffsets team hosted a live webinar to share key data-driven insights from our 2025 Voluntary Carbon Market Recap.
In the session, the AlliedOffsets team walked through how the voluntary carbon market evolved over the past year, drawing on findings from our latest end-of-year report. The presentation was followed by a live audience Q&A.
The discussion covered several of the major themes shaping the market, including:
- The continued decline in annual oversupply across the voluntary carbon market
- Country-level Article 6 readiness and updates following COP29 and COP30
- Trends in CCP-labelled retirements over time
- Developments and projections around CORSIA supply
